Firefighters were able to secure two massive air conditioning units that dangled off the edge of a Yonkers building as a result of the whipping winds Wednesday evening.
Each unit weighs about 5,000 pounds each. They dangled from a 26-story residential building under construction on Warburton and Main streets in Getty Square just after 4 p.m.
Firefighters were able to secure the units by using a combination of hoist straps and cables until construction crews responded and secured the units tightly in place.
Construction crews will remove those units to another location. Until then, that area remains closed.
